Smart GPS Can Increase Electric Vehicle Range

Researchers at the Univ. of California, Riverside believe they can extend the range of electric vehicles by at least 10 percent by taking into account real-time traffic information, road type and grade and passenger and cargo weight. The researchers, who work at the Center for Environmental Research and Technology (CE-CERT), which is part of the Bourns College of Engineering, have received a nearly $95,000 one-year grant from the California Energy Commission to develop a eco-routing algorithm that finds the route requiring the least amount of energy for a trip.
